What is "waffle"?

A waffle is a type of breakfast food that is popular around the world. It is made from a batter of flour, eggs, milk, sugar, and butter, which is cooked in a waffle iron until it becomes golden brown and crispy on the outside and soft and fluffy on the inside. Waffles can be served with a variety of toppings, including butter, syrup, whipped cream, fruit, or chocolate chips. They can also be made savory by adding cheese, herbs, or bacon to the batter. Waffles are a versatile food that can be enjoyed at any time of the day and are a favorite among both children and adults.
